The engine of a truck loaded with potatoes caught fire Tuesday night on Interstate 295 in Bowdoinham, Maine State Police said.

Police said the engine of the truck, which was heading south from St. Agatha in Aroostook County, burst into flames around 7:47 p.m.

The driver, whose name was unavailable, escaped. The fire was quickly brought under control, but I-295 had to be shut down for about 30 minutes.

The driver tried to douse the fire with an extinguisher, but was unsuccessful. The trailer where the potatoes were stored was not damaged.
